Q: How does bearing contamination affect RA 570-813-13 performance?
A: Dust, moisture, and metal particles cause premature bearing wear and failure. Contamination increases friction, generates heat, and degrades the bearing raceway. Keep bearing seals intact and store in a dry environment before installation.
Q: Can RA 570-813-13 be repaired or must it be replaced?
A: Ball bearings cannot be repaired. Once damaged, cracked, or worn beyond tolerance, they must be replaced. Attempting to repair a failed bearing risks further equipment damage.
